This product is used for insulation and suspension of conductors in high-voltage and ultra high voltage AC/DC transmission lines. The product consists of iron caps, tempered glass pieces, and steel feet, which are bonded together with cement adhesive. This product adopts the international cylindrical head structure, which is characterized by a small head size. Lightweight, high strength, and large creepage distance. Can save metal materials and reduce line costs. To meet the needs of live working, traditional domestic structural shapes are used on the brim of the hat. Zero value self breaking, easy to detect.Tempered glass insulators have the characteristic of zero value self rupture. As long as it is observed on the ground or in a helicopter, there is no need to climb the pole and inspect each piece, which reduces the labor intensity of workers. The annual self destruction rate during operation is0.02—0.04%It can save maintenance costs for the line. The glass insulator has good resistance to arc and vibration during operation. The new surface of the glass insulator, which has been damaged by lightning, is still a smooth glass body with a tempered internal stress protection layer. Therefore, it still maintains sufficient insulation and mechanical strength.

       in500kvThere have been multiple incidents of conductor icing causing vibration on the line, and the glass insulators that have been affected by conductor vibration have been tested and found to have no degradation in mechanical and electrical performance. Good self-cleaning performance and resistance to aging. According to the general feedback from the power department, glass insulators are not easy to accumulate dirt and are easy to clean. The glass insulators used in the southern transmission lines are washed clean after rain. Regularly sampling and measuring the mechanical and electrical performance of glass insulators on typical regional power lines after operation, accumulating thousands of data indicating operationthirty-fiveThe mechanical and electrical performance of the glass insulator after the year is basically the same as that at the time of leaving the factory, and there is no aging phenomenon. Large main capacity, uniform voltage distribution in series.The dielectric constant of glass7-8Making glass insulators have a large main capacitance and uniform voltage distribution in series is beneficial for reducing the voltage borne by insulators near the wire side and grounding side, thereby achieving the goal of reducing radio interference, reducing corona losses, and extending the life of glass insulators. Practical operation has proven this.

      Packaging and transportation requirements for glass insulators:

      Glass insulator packaging

      It is recommended to use a single cylindrical packaging method for insulators. The packaging should have measures to prevent rodent damage and deformation, and should be stored properly in the warehouse.

      Transportation of composite insulators

      The transportation and handling of insulators must be carried out with intact packaging. When the length of the insulator exceeds the body of the transport vehicle, additional measures should be taken

      Take measures to prevent insulator deformation.

      When handling insulators of 330kV and above with removed outer packaging, they should be handled smoothly to prevent excessive scratching of the insulators.
